差别

这里会显示出您选择的修订版和当前版本之间的差别。

到此差别页面的链接

两侧同时换到之前的修订记录 前一修订版
后一修订版
前一修订版
pir [2023/07/14 11:32]
gaohancheng
pir [2023/07/24 09:47] (当前版本)
gaohancheng
行 3: 行 3:
 ### 1. 什么是无源红外传感器? ### 1. 什么是无源红外传感器?
 PIR全称为Passive Infra-Red,称作被动红外传感器(又被称为Pyroelectric Infrared——热释电红外线传感器)是近年来发展起来的一种新型高灵敏度探测元件,是一种能检测人体发射的红外线而输出电信号的传感器。它能组成防入侵报警器或各种自动化节能装置。它能以非接触形式检测出人体辐射的红外线能量的变化,并将其转换成电压信号输出。将这个电压信号加以放大,​便可驱动各种控制电路,如作电源开关控制、防盗防火报警等。 PIR全称为Passive Infra-Red,称作被动红外传感器(又被称为Pyroelectric Infrared——热释电红外线传感器)是近年来发展起来的一种新型高灵敏度探测元件,是一种能检测人体发射的红外线而输出电信号的传感器。它能组成防入侵报警器或各种自动化节能装置。它能以非接触形式检测出人体辐射的红外线能量的变化,并将其转换成电压信号输出。将这个电压信号加以放大,​便可驱动各种控制电路,如作电源开关控制、防盗防火报警等。
 +{{ :​r-c.png?​500 |}}
 红外线传感器是将红外辐射能转换成电能的一种光敏元件,​通常将红外线传感器分为热型和光子型两种。热释电红外传感器是利用红外辐射的热辐射作用引起元件本身的温度变化,​其探测率、响应速度都不如光子型传感器。但由于热释电型传感器可在室温下使用,​灵敏度与波长无关,​所以应用领域广。通用性好的热型传感器有热电堆、热敏电阻测辐射热计、高莱管等。其中,​利用铁电体热释电效应的热释电型红外传感器(PIR)灵敏度高,​可以广泛地用于民用领域。 红外线传感器是将红外辐射能转换成电能的一种光敏元件,​通常将红外线传感器分为热型和光子型两种。热释电红外传感器是利用红外辐射的热辐射作用引起元件本身的温度变化,​其探测率、响应速度都不如光子型传感器。但由于热释电型传感器可在室温下使用,​灵敏度与波长无关,​所以应用领域广。通用性好的热型传感器有热电堆、热敏电阻测辐射热计、高莱管等。其中,​利用铁电体热释电效应的热释电型红外传感器(PIR)灵敏度高,​可以广泛地用于民用领域。
  
行 15: 行 15:
 由于PIR只能检测到距离有限。如果在外面加上一个菲涅尔透镜(下图),把外部的光线会聚到 PIR 上,增加进光量,则可大大增加 PIR 的检测距离和角度。同时,通过控制菲涅耳透鏡内部的角度,可以控制焦距,制作出检测距离不同.的 PIR。做完这些工作之后,有了一定的检测距离和角度。但是人体必须经过整个检测区域才能产生两次变化(进入检测区和离开检测区)。我们希望能够检测到更小幅度的移动,捕获更多的变化信号。在菲涅尔透镜上做点变化,把检测区分成若干个小格,间隔的区域会把光反射出去。这样整个检测区就变成若干个相邻的灵敏区和盲区。当人体移动时,会经过一个灵敏区,又进入一个盲区…… 最后产生连续的脉冲信号。 由于PIR只能检测到距离有限。如果在外面加上一个菲涅尔透镜(下图),把外部的光线会聚到 PIR 上,增加进光量,则可大大增加 PIR 的检测距离和角度。同时,通过控制菲涅耳透鏡内部的角度,可以控制焦距,制作出检测距离不同.的 PIR。做完这些工作之后,有了一定的检测距离和角度。但是人体必须经过整个检测区域才能产生两次变化(进入检测区和离开检测区)。我们希望能够检测到更小幅度的移动,捕获更多的变化信号。在菲涅尔透镜上做点变化,把检测区分成若干个小格,间隔的区域会把光反射出去。这样整个检测区就变成若干个相邻的灵敏区和盲区。当人体移动时,会经过一个灵敏区,又进入一个盲区…… 最后产生连续的脉冲信号。
 {{ :​菲涅尔.jpg?​500 |}} {{ :​菲涅尔.jpg?​500 |}}
 +菲涅尔透镜可以聚光,为传感器提供更大范围的红外光。
 +{{ :​lens_f.png?​500 |}}
 +好了,现在我们有了一个更大的范围。但是实际上我们有两个传感器,更重要的是,我们不需要两个非常大的感应区域矩形,而是需要分散的多个小区域。因此,我们要做的是将透镜分成多个部分,每个部分都是菲涅尔透镜。
 +{{ :​lens_f2.jpg?​500 |}}
 +上面这张微距照片展示了每个切面上不同的菲涅尔透镜;
 {{ :​人体感应.png?​500 |}} {{ :​人体感应.png?​500 |}}
 由上文可知,人体都有恒定的体温,一般在37°C左右,会发出10 um左右特定波长的红外线,被动式红外探头就是靠探测人体发射的红外线而进行工作的。红外线通过菲涅耳滤光片增强后聚集到热释电元件,这种元件在接收到人体红外辐射变化时就会失去电荷平衡,向外释放电荷,后经检测处理后就能产生报警信号。被动红外探头,其传感器包含两个互相串联或并联的热释电元件,而且制成的两个电极化方向正好相反(如下图所示),环境背景辐射对两个热释元件几乎具有相同的作用,使其产生释电效应相互抵消,于是探测器无信号输出。 由上文可知,人体都有恒定的体温,一般在37°C左右,会发出10 um左右特定波长的红外线,被动式红外探头就是靠探测人体发射的红外线而进行工作的。红外线通过菲涅耳滤光片增强后聚集到热释电元件,这种元件在接收到人体红外辐射变化时就会失去电荷平衡,向外释放电荷,后经检测处理后就能产生报警信号。被动红外探头,其传感器包含两个互相串联或并联的热释电元件,而且制成的两个电极化方向正好相反(如下图所示),环境背景辐射对两个热释元件几乎具有相同的作用,使其产生释电效应相互抵消,于是探测器无信号输出。
行 46: 行 51:
   * 普通列表项目探测范围:最大可达10mm。   * 普通列表项目探测范围:最大可达10mm。
  
-### 4. 主要的无源红外传感器供应商 +目前PIR传感器有以下用处
-  * [[https://​www.st.com/​content/​st_com/​en.html|意法半导体(STMicroelectronics)]]:作为全球领先半导体公司之一,意法半导体提供了多种无源红外传感器产品,包括接近传感器、手势识别传感器和红外遥控解码器。 +
-  * [[https://​www.vishay.com/​|美国电气(Vishay)]]美国电气是一家专注于电子元件制造的公司,其产品线包括多种无源红外传感器,如红外接收器、红外发射器和红外光栅。 +
-  * [[https://​www.seagate.com/​|希捷科技(Seagate Technology)]]:希捷科技是一家专注于硬盘驱动器和存储解决方案的公司,其产品中也包含无源红外传感器,用于硬盘驱动器的故障诊断和校准等功能。 +
-  * [[https://​www.nysenba.com/​|森霸传感]]:​森霸传感科技是国内热释电红外传感器龙头厂商,有19年传感器自主研发经验,是国产中红外传感器厂商的中流砥柱。 +
-### 5. 参考案例+
   * 安防系统:PIR传感器常用于安防系统,例如家庭安全系统或办公室安全系统。当有人进入被监控的区域时,PIR传感器会检测到其体温所产生的红外辐射变化,并触发警报或其他相应的安全措施。   * 安防系统:PIR传感器常用于安防系统,例如家庭安全系统或办公室安全系统。当有人进入被监控的区域时,PIR传感器会检测到其体温所产生的红外辐射变化,并触发警报或其他相应的安全措施。
 +{{ :​rc2.jpg?​300 |}}
   * 照明控制:PIR传感器可用于自动控制照明系统。通过检测房间内是否有人活动,PIR传感器可以向控制器发送信号,从而控制灯光的开关和亮度,实现智能节能的照明系统。   * 照明控制:PIR传感器可用于自动控制照明系统。通过检测房间内是否有人活动,PIR传感器可以向控制器发送信号,从而控制灯光的开关和亮度,实现智能节能的照明系统。
 +{{ :​rc3.jpg?​300 |}}
   * 自动化系统:PIR传感器也广泛应用于建筑自动化系统,如自动门、自动电梯和自动洗手间等。当有人接近时,PIR传感器可以检测到并触发相应的自动化操作,提供方便性和舒适性。   * 自动化系统:PIR传感器也广泛应用于建筑自动化系统,如自动门、自动电梯和自动洗手间等。当有人接近时,PIR传感器可以检测到并触发相应的自动化操作,提供方便性和舒适性。
 +{{ :​rc5.jpg?​300 |}}
   * 能源管理:PIR传感器可用于能源管理系统,例如管理办公室或商店中的空调和供暖系统。当检测到没有人活动时,传感器可以自动降低或关闭能源消耗较高的设备,以节省能源。   * 能源管理:PIR传感器可用于能源管理系统,例如管理办公室或商店中的空调和供暖系统。当检测到没有人活动时,传感器可以自动降低或关闭能源消耗较高的设备,以节省能源。
 +{{ :​rc7.jpg?​300 |}}
   * 应用于健康监测:在医疗领域,PIR传感器可用于监测人体的运动和活动,例如睡眠监测、老年人护理等。通过检测身体的微小运动,传感器可以提供有关人体活动模式和健康状况的信息。   * 应用于健康监测:在医疗领域,PIR传感器可用于监测人体的运动和活动,例如睡眠监测、老年人护理等。通过检测身体的微小运动,传感器可以提供有关人体活动模式和健康状况的信息。
 +{{ :​rc8.jpg?​300 |}}
 +### 4. 主要的无源红外传感器供应商
 +  * **[[https://​www.st.com/​content/​st_com/​en.html|意法半导体(STMicroelectronics)]]**:作为全球领先的半导体公司之一,意法半导体提供了多种无源红外传感器产品,包括接近传感器、手势识别传感器和红外遥控解码器。
 +  * **[[https://​www.vishay.com/​|美国电气(Vishay)]]**:美国电气是一家专注于电子元件制造的公司,其产品线包括多种无源红外传感器,如红外接收器、红外发射器和红外光栅。
 +  * **[[https://​www.seagate.com/​|希捷科技(Seagate Technology)]]**:希捷科技是一家专注于硬盘驱动器和存储解决方案的公司,其产品中也包含无源红外传感器,用于硬盘驱动器的故障诊断和校准等功能。
 +  * **[[https://​www.nysenba.com/​|森霸传感]]**:森霸传感科技是国内热释电红外传感器龙头厂商,有19年传感器自主研发经验,是国产中红外传感器厂商的中流砥柱。
 +
 +### 5. 参考案列
 +针对与本次无源红外传感器,我们采用了GY——906无源红外温度传感器(基本原理与PIR传感器没有太大差别)与基于RP2040的逻辑/​协议/​信号调试助手——十二指神探进行联接,通过micropython语言来编译相关代码,实现其功能:
 +{{ :​rp2040_datasheet.png?​500 |}}
 +代码如下:
  
 + from machine import Pin, I2C
 + ​import time
 + 
 + i2c = I2C(1, scl=Pin(23),​ sda=Pin(22))
 + ​address = 0x5A
 + 
 + while True:
 +    i2c.writeto(address,​ bytearray([0x07])
 +    time.sleep_ms(500)  ​
 +   
 +    # 读取温度数据
 +    data = i2c.readfrom(address,​ 3)  ​
 +    temp_raw = (data[0] << 8) + data[1]  ​
 +    temp_celsius = (temp_raw * 0.02) - 273.15  ​
 +    temp_fahrenheit = (temp_celsius * 9 / 5) + 32  ​
 +    ​
 +    print("​Temperature:​ {:.2f}°C / {:​.2f}°F"​.format(temp_celsius,​ temp_fahrenheit))
 +    ​
 +    time.sleep(1) ​